<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ic IDOC CREATION in Application Development and Automation Discussions</title>
    <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821241#M659869</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;     This is joy.....&lt;/P&gt;&lt;P&gt;   Can any one please clear my confusion on idoc creation....&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;1.After i create the structure of an idoc using we31,we30,we81,we82 and associate a function module&lt;/P&gt;&lt;P&gt;next wot are the steps....?&lt;/P&gt;&lt;P&gt;2.this is my mail id&lt;/P&gt;&lt;P&gt; jyotirmoy_db@yahoo.co.in&lt;/P&gt;&lt;P&gt;ph: 9962241708&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;if any body know s please contact me asap.&lt;/P&gt;&lt;P&gt;                                   joy&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Thu, 20 Sep 2007 07:32:30 GMT</pubDate>
    <dc:creator>Former Member</dc:creator>
    <dc:date>2007-09-20T07:32:30Z</dc:date>
    <item>
      <title>I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821241#M659869</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;     This is joy.....&lt;/P&gt;&lt;P&gt;   Can any one please clear my confusion on idoc creation....&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;1.After i create the structure of an idoc using we31,we30,we81,we82 and associate a function module&lt;/P&gt;&lt;P&gt;next wot are the steps....?&lt;/P&gt;&lt;P&gt;2.this is my mail id&lt;/P&gt;&lt;P&gt; jyotirmoy_db@yahoo.co.in&lt;/P&gt;&lt;P&gt;ph: 9962241708&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;if any body know s please contact me asap.&lt;/P&gt;&lt;P&gt;                                   joy&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:32:30 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821241#M659869</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:32:30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821242#M659870</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Check the following link:&lt;/P&gt;&lt;P&gt;&lt;A href="http://www.sapbrainsonline.com/TUTORIALS/TECHNICAL/IDOC_tutorial.html" target="test_blank"&gt;http://www.sapbrainsonline.com/TUTORIALS/TECHNICAL/IDOC_tutorial.html&lt;/A&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Bhaskar&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:36:58 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821242#M659870</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:36:58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821243#M659871</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;thanks vaskar&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:43:32 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821243#M659871</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:43:32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821244#M659872</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Follow the steps below:&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;1. WE31 -&lt;/P&gt;&lt;HR originaltext="---" /&gt;&lt;P&gt;&amp;gt; to add segments to the basic idoc type and release the segment&lt;/P&gt;&lt;P&gt;2. WE30 -&lt;/P&gt;&lt;HR originaltext="---" /&gt;&lt;P&gt;&amp;gt; extending the basic idoc type with the new segments and release the idoc type.&lt;/P&gt;&lt;P&gt;3.WE82 -&lt;/P&gt;&lt;HR originaltext="----" /&gt;&lt;P&gt;&amp;gt; assiging the message type to extended idoc type.&lt;/P&gt;&lt;P&gt;4. WE57 -&lt;/P&gt;&lt;HR originaltext="----" /&gt;&lt;P&gt;&amp;gt; assigning the msg type and ext idoc type to FM.&lt;/P&gt;&lt;P&gt;5. Change the FM to pull the data and pass the data into segments thru we41 or we42.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;P&gt;Kannaiah&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:44:10 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821244#M659872</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:44:10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821245#M659873</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;for a outbound IDOC:&lt;/P&gt;&lt;P&gt;1) Define a Port (WE21)&lt;/P&gt;&lt;P&gt;2) Define a logical destination (SALE)&lt;/P&gt;&lt;P&gt;3) Mantain a distribution model (SALE)&lt;/P&gt;&lt;P&gt;4) Define a Output Type (NACE)&lt;/P&gt;&lt;P&gt;5) Define Procedure for your output type (NACE)&lt;/P&gt;&lt;P&gt;6) Define Outbound process code (WE41)&lt;/P&gt;&lt;P&gt;6) Define a logical message for your outbound process code (WE41)&lt;/P&gt;&lt;P&gt;7) Asign your message type to the IDOC-Type (WE82)&lt;/P&gt;&lt;P&gt;&lt;span class="lia-unicode-emoji" title=":smiling_face_with_sunglasses:"&gt;😎&lt;/span&gt; Define a Partner profile (WE20)&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;WE02, BD87 to monitor the outgoing IDOCS..&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I hope this help a little bit..&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Gianpietro&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:46:47 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821245#M659873</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:46:47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821246#M659874</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;follow this steps also.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Create function module with the following&lt;/P&gt;&lt;P&gt;1 ) Parameters in function Module&lt;/P&gt;&lt;P&gt;Import :&lt;/P&gt;&lt;P&gt;INPUT_METHOD LIKE BDWFAP_PAR-INPUTMETHD&lt;/P&gt;&lt;P&gt;MASS_PROCESSING LIKE BDWFAP_PAR-MASS_PROC&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Export :&lt;/P&gt;&lt;P&gt;WORKFLOW_RESULT LIKE BDWFAP_PAR-RESULT&lt;/P&gt;&lt;P&gt;APPLICATION_VARIABLE LIKE BDWFAP_PAR-APPL_VAR&lt;/P&gt;&lt;P&gt;IN_UPDATE_TASK LIKE BDWFAP_PAR-UPDATETASK&lt;/P&gt;&lt;P&gt;CALL_TRANSACTION_DONE LIKE BDWFAP_PAR-CALLTRANS&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Tables:&lt;/P&gt;&lt;P&gt;IDOC_CONTRL LIKE EDIDC&lt;/P&gt;&lt;P&gt;IDOC_DATA LIKE EDIDD&lt;/P&gt;&lt;P&gt;IDOC_STATUS LIKE BDIDOCSTAT&lt;/P&gt;&lt;P&gt;RETURN_VARIABLES LIKE BDWFRETVAR&lt;/P&gt;&lt;P&gt;SERIALIZATION_INFO LIKE BDI_SER&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Exception:&lt;/P&gt;&lt;P&gt;WRONG_FUNCTION_CALLED Wrong function module for message&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;NOTE : these import,export and table parameters can be get from any standard IDOC F.M&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;2) The function module gets created when you enter the above specified import, export, tables and exception. Then in the source code tab of function module write the required code for processing the IDOC.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;3)Once the function module is created add Idoc type and related data using the transaction WE 57.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;4)Go to transaction WE 57 add function module name and type as &amp;#145;F&amp;#146; . Also add the basic type and Message type in the transaction and then save and close&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;5)Go to transaction BD 51 add the function module and the input type as 0 or 1 or 2. this identifies the type of processing of the IDOC&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;For PROCESS CODE&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;6)Now we have to create a Process code for the above using Transaction WE 42.&lt;/P&gt;&lt;P&gt;Go to transaction WE 42 click on Change display button.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;7) Once you are in the change mode enter Process code, Description for the Process code and in the identification enter the function Module name also click radio buttons processing with ALE and processing by function module and save the trasaction.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;8)Once you the save the WE 42 transaction, you get a green/yellow button next to the function module click on that it takes you to a new window.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;9)Drop down the arrow next to the function module you should be able to find the function module which you have created, now save you have your process code created. Now test the IDOC&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Summary for customizing idoc and F.M.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Points:&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;WE 31: Create Segments(Fields)&lt;/P&gt;&lt;P&gt;WE 30: Create IDOC Type( attach segments to the IDOC type.&lt;/P&gt;&lt;P&gt;WE 81: Create Message Type.&lt;/P&gt;&lt;P&gt;WE 82: Assign Message type to IDOC type&lt;/P&gt;&lt;P&gt;Create Function Module&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;WE 57: Add function Module Details&lt;/P&gt;&lt;P&gt;BD 51: Add function Module &amp;amp; Corresponding input&lt;/P&gt;&lt;P&gt;WE 42: Create Process code&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;reward if useful.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:52:00 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821246#M659874</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:52:00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821247#M659875</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;1.what is process code in an IDOC CREATION?&lt;/P&gt;&lt;P&gt;2.Why do we need to associate process code and function module?&lt;/P&gt;&lt;P&gt;2.Can we perform the whole IDOC creation manually by using transactions or we need to write an abap report in SE38 seperately? if so why?&lt;/P&gt;&lt;P&gt;3.What does this report do?&lt;/P&gt;&lt;P&gt;4.i need to discuss in details......can any one contact me plz&lt;/P&gt;&lt;P&gt;india-chennai 9962241708&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 07:54:56 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821247#M659875</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T07:54:56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821248#M659876</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;There are two ways of sending idocs.1. Directly thru application (incase of Master applications) and 2. Thrus message control (in case of transactional application data PO and Sales Order and delivery). &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;For message control we need to generate idoc through output type. &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Kannaiah&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 08:00:15 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821248#M659876</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T08:00:15Z</dc:date>
    </item>
    <item>
      <title>Re: IDOC CREATION</title>
      <link>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821249#M659877</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hey Man thanks....it was really usefull.....&lt;/P&gt;&lt;P&gt;But I have another query&lt;/P&gt;&lt;P&gt;Are the above steps are final or,&lt;/P&gt;&lt;P&gt;You didnt tell about the Report which I have to write.....in SE38&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 20 Sep 2007 09:33:55 GMT</pubDate>
      <guid>https://community.sap.com/t5/application-development-and-automation-discussions/idoc-creation/m-p/2821249#M659877</guid>
      <dc:creator>Former Member</dc:creator>
      <dc:date>2007-09-20T09:33:55Z</dc:date>
    </item>
  </channel>
</rss>

